BELLOWS FALLS, VERMONT

PRESS RELEASE 2016

Art Exhibit: August through October- Abstract and Landscape Photography of Jimmy ienner, Jr. 

Opening Reception: August 19th, 4pm to 7pm, in conjunction with BF3F

Location: Flat Iron Exchange, 51 the Square, Bellows Falls, VT 05101

Starting August 1st, and throughout the month of October, the Flat Iron Exchange will be showcasing the photographic artwork of Jimmy ienner, Jr. 

Jimmy’s true passion lies in landscape photography and photojournalism. He has been enamored with railroads since he was young, even having his own model train room as a boy. His passion led him to Bellows Falls, Vermont in the summer of 1993.  Being one of a selected few given private access to the Green Mountain Railroad, Jimmy fell in love with the environment in which Bellows Falls sits. Year after year, Jimmy has returned with camera in hand, slowly acquiring a large catalogue of images. He now brings to you some of his work from years in the making of Abstract and Landscape photography. The shots represent the Old Railroad and Old Mills in Bellows Falls VT, including some shots taken just across the river in New Hampshire at the Historic Round House. Partial proceeds to benefit The Preservation Trust of Vermont projects within the town of Rockingham.

MYSTERIOUS TOWN CENTRALIA PENNSYLVANIA STILL BURNS

Its population has dwindled from over 1,000 residents in 1981 to 10 in 2012 as a result of a mine fire burning beneath the borough since 1962. Centralia is the least-populated municipality in Pennsylvania. Roger Avery, director of the “Silent Hill” movie, has said part of his inspiration for the movie was from Centralia. What helped me during the post-production process was listening to the Carnivàle soundtrack.
